How to Decorate With a Gray Couch With Chaise

In natural, synthetic or performance fabrics that conceal dirt and staining, gray sofas stand up to frequent use. Find patterns on pillows or rugs that work with your couch's color to create a polished, coordinated appearance.

A comfortable grey sofa brings warmth to a living room with dark wood accent furniture and moldings. To freshen up the look, change throw pillows or roll out a new rug.

Elegant

Grey couches are the ideal base for your living space design. They can be mixed and matched with different styles and colors. They work well with warmer shades like yellow, coral and pink and cooler shades like navy and teal blues. They can be used to create a transitional style that blends traditional and contemporary furniture styles.

You can style up or down a grey couch with the right pillows and curtains. Throw Sofas And Couches with vibrant patterns and colors can lighten the look of your sofa, whereas simple rugs in natural or beige colors provide a comfortable, calming look to your living space. Gray sectional couches also look great with neutral colored curtains or wall paints as well as wood accents and wooden furniture.

Gray sofa with chaise provides luxury and style that can serve as the focal point in any room. It can also serve as a blank slate for decorative chairs and other furnishings. If you want a striking style, select a sofa in an darker hue than the walls, and then decorate with lighter accent pieces. If you're looking for a subtle impact, select an option that is lighter or darker than the wall color.

A grey couch with chaise is a great choice for contemporary and transitional living room designs. It complements the sleek lines and is well-integrated with neutrals. It's also a good choice for rooms with lots of sunlight, since it helps to increase the brightness of the space without overwhelming the view. If you're looking to add a touch of warmth, try pairing your gray sectional with wood furniture or exposed brick. Gray furniture is also a good match with various textures, including rattan, which is particularly suitable for cabin or vacation home living rooms.

Yellow is a fantastic color to add some zing to your grey sofa and chaise. This shade is an excellent complement to grey and works well in a range of shades, from pale yellow to mustard. Throw pillows and blankets in yellow can create a warm, comfortable space.

Other colors that go well with grey are blue green, purple, and blue. You can also use patterns on rugs or pillows to create an interesting eclectic look. For a less formal look, you can try using the rug with a geometric design or selecting a pillow with an elegant pattern.

Grey sectionals are a great option for any room, but they're especially good for bedrooms and home office. It's a neutral color that goes well with other furniture types and won't become outdated like furniture in brighter colors. In a home office or bedroom the grey sectional may be used as a base to the furniture in the rest of the room and help keep the room organized and tidy.

You can also add a dash of color to your grey sectional by adding a vibrantly colored rug. A pink rug is the ideal combination for a grey sofa. The two colors work perfectly to create a chic look that's sure to impress your guests.


You can also pick a rug with a darker shade to match your grey sofa. A charcoal or black rug will work well with a grey sofa, and it can help to bring the furniture down in the room. Consider a white rug to match or contrast your grey sofa if prefer lighter shades. When selecting a rug, it is important to take into account the dimensions and shape of your space.
